Held...ah forgotten...in the cellar since release. Bottle and cork in great shape, just like the relationship by report. Soft 'pop' on opening. Yeast and caramel on the nose. Fine stream of bubbles from the base of the tulip glass. Palate is smooth with no bitterness (not really getting any hop aroma or taste), flavors are a light taste of dinner roll, a touch sweet on the finish. Very enjoyable. Going down great on this warm Asheville evening with the Katydids going in the background. Great to see it held together well these three years
